**Jekyll电子商务模板详解** Jekyll是一个静态站点生成器,它使用Markdown、Textile或纯HTML等文本格式,结合Liquid模板语言,将内容转化为静态HTML页面。这种工具非常适合用于构建博客、个人网站或是轻量级的电子商务平台。"jekyll-ecommerce-template"即是一个专为Jekyll设计的电子商务网站模板,旨在帮助开发者快速搭建在线商店,无需复杂的服务器端编程,只需关注产品展示和用户体验。 1. **HTML基础** HTML(超文本标记语言)是构建网页的基础,它定义了网页的结构和内容。在"jekyll-ecommerce-template"中,HTML文件用于创建商品列表、购物车、结账流程等电子商务关键页面。开发者可以编辑这些HTML文件,自定义页面布局,添加产品分类,以及调整导航栏和页脚信息。 2. **Liquid模板语言** Jekyll的核心部分就是Liquid,它是一种安全的、用于渲染静态页面的模板语言。在模板中,你可以使用变量、控制流语句(如条件语句和循环)以及标签来动态生成内容。例如,商品详情页可能使用 Liquid 来循环遍历数据库中的商品信息,并将其显示在页面上。 3. **数据管理** 在Jekyll中,数据通常存储在_YAML格式的_data文件夹中。对于电子商务网站,这可能包括产品信息、类别、价格、库存等。开发者可以通过修改这些YAML文件来更新产品数据,Jekyll会自动处理并生成新的HTML页面。 4. **CSS与响应式设计** 为了提供良好的用户体验,"jekyll-ecommerce-template"很可能包含了CSS(层叠样式表)文件,用于控制页面的样式和布局。CSS允许开发者定义字体、颜色、间距等视觉元素,并实现响应式设计,确保网站在不同设备上都能正常显示和操作,适应手机、平板和桌面电脑的屏幕尺寸。 5. **JavaScript交互** 虽然Jekyll生成的是静态页面,但通过引入JavaScript库,可以实现一些交互功能,如添加到购物车、实时计算总价等。这些功能通常通过在HTML文件中插入内联JavaScript代码或链接外部JS文件来实现。 6. **GitHub Pages集成** "jekyll-ecommerce-template-gh-pages"暗示这个模板可能是为GitHub Pages准备的。GitHub Pages是一个免费的托管服务,可以用于发布个人或项目网站。Jekyll与GitHub Pages完美兼容,只需将源代码推送到特定分支,GitHub就会自动构建和部署网站。 7. **SEO优化** 对于电子商务网站,搜索引擎优化(SEO)至关重要,以便潜在客户能够找到你的商店。Jekyll支持添加元标签和自定义URL,这些都可以提升网站在搜索结果中的排名。 8. **支付集成** 虽然Jekyll本身不处理支付,但可以集成第三方支付服务(如PayPal、Stripe等),通过API实现在线支付功能。这需要开发者具备一定的后端知识,但Jekyll的静态特性使得安全性和性能得到了保证。 总结来说,"jekyll-ecommerce-template"是一个基于Jekyll的电子商务解决方案,利用HTML、Liquid、CSS和JavaScript等技术,提供了一个轻量级且易于维护的在线商店框架。开发者可以根据自身需求对模板进行定制,快速构建出具有专业外观和功能的电子商务网站。
2025-04-13 21:36:21 2.91MB HTML
1
程序结合易语言WEB浏览器支持库实现简单HTML编辑功能。
2025-04-12 19:55:16 12KB
1
用一些软件导出的html代码用notepad++打开后发现就是一行了。没法看。找了找代码格式化软件。tidy2感觉不错。但是使用Notepad++软件,选择插件菜单——Plugin Manager——Show Plugin Manager,在插件列表中找到tidy2进行安装时总是报错: installation of tidy2 failed (我已经翻墙了并且能下载,但是下载完成后就报这个错误),于是只能使用手动安装。手动安装实际就是把 Tidy2.dll 文件放到安装目录里去,安装很简单,找到notepad++安装路径,一般为C:Program FilesNotepad++plugins,放到目录里,重启notepad++即可。
2025-04-10 21:28:49 111KB html
1
可以快速知道自己网站运行状态。 网址管理功能 添加网址:用户可以在输入框中输入要监测的网页地址,点击 “添加网址” 按钮,工具会对输入的网址进行格式验证。验证通过后,网址会被添加到左侧面板的列表中,并且列表项后有 “删除” 按钮。 删除网址:在左侧面板的网址列表中,每个网址后面都有一个 “删除” 按钮,点击该按钮可以将对应的网址从监测列表中移除,同时也会从筛选下拉框中移除该网址选项。 筛选网址:右侧面板有一个 “筛选网址” 的下拉框,用户可以选择具体的网址进行筛选,只显示该网址的监测日志,也可以选择 “全部” 来显示所有网址的监测日志。 监测功能 设置监测间隔:用户可以在输入框中设置监测间隔时间(单位为秒),默认值为 60 秒。 开始 / 停止监测:点击 “开始监测” 按钮,工具会立即对所有已添加的网址进行一次检测,之后按照设置的监测间隔时间循环检测。点击 “停止监测” 按钮可停止监测。 重试机制:在进行网址检测时,如果请求失败,会进行最多 3 次重试,若重试后仍失败,则记录错误日志。 日志记录与显示功能 日志记录:每次对网址进行检测后,会记录网址的状态(正常或异常)、响应时间、时间戳
2025-04-10 10:55:39 4KB HTML
1
HTML/CSS/JavaScript是网页开发的三大核心技术,它们共同构成了现代网页的基础。这份"HTML/CSS/JavaScript标准教程实例版(第三版)PPT"涵盖了这些领域的核心概念和实践技巧,旨在帮助学习者掌握创建交互式和动态网页的技能。 HTML(HyperText Markup Language)是用于构建网页内容结构的语言,它定义了网页的各个元素,如标题、段落、图片、链接等。在第三版的教程中,可能会深入讲解HTML5的新特性,如语义化标签、离线存储、音频视频处理等,这些都是现代网页开发不可或缺的部分。通过20.ppt、19.ppt等文件,我们可以预期涵盖HTML的基本语法、元素嵌套规则、表单处理以及如何利用HTML5提升用户体验。 CSS(Cascading Style Sheets)则负责网页的样式和布局设计。学习者将了解到选择器的用法、盒模型、定位技术、响应式设计等关键概念,以实现美观且适应不同设备的网页界面。13.ppt、09.ppt等文件可能详细解析了CSS的各个模块,包括颜色、字体、边距、布局以及CSS3的新特性,如阴影、渐变、动画和多列布局。 JavaScript是一种强大的脚本语言,常用于网页的动态效果和用户交互。教程中,可能会讲解变量、数据类型、函数、事件处理等基础语法,以及DOM操作、AJAX异步通信、Promise和async/await等高级话题。17.ppt、15.ppt、14.ppt等可能包含JavaScript编程的实例,教授如何通过JavaScript实现动态效果,如图片轮播、表单验证、时间戳转换等。 此外,"实例版"意味着教程注重实践,通过每个PPT文件中的案例,学习者可以亲手操作,巩固理论知识。这种学习方式有助于提高理解和应用能力,使学习者能够快速掌握这些技术,并应用于实际项目中。 这个教程全面覆盖了前端开发的三个主要方面,无论你是初学者还是希望更新技能的专业人士,都能从中受益。通过深入学习并实践这些PPT中的内容,你将具备创建功能完备、交互丰富的现代网页的能力。
2025-04-10 10:02:32 30.56MB HTML JavaScript 标准教程实例版
1
节点红色贡献redplc 软件可编程逻辑控制器(PLC)的红色节点 安装 使用Node-Red Palette Manager或npm命令安装: npm install node-red-contrib-redplc 用法 redPlc节点在Node-Red中实现Software PLC功能。 控制逻辑根据IEC 61131-3标准实现为(LD)。 redPlc节点将Node-Red的图形环境用于编写控制逻辑任务。 redPlc用纯Javascript编写,可在所有平台上使用运行Node-Red的平台。 模块节点将硬件或通信数据映射到全局变量。 必须安装的模块节点取决于使用的硬件或通信。 全局变量使用预定义的唯一名称和格式。 每个变量都是唯一的,带有后续的地址编号。 地址范围是0..999。 为了便于处理,redPlc仅具有数据类型UINT32,LREAL和WSTRING。
2025-04-09 16:40:07 56KB HTML
1
标题中的“APP应用下载页,模板2 响应式,支持免填邀请码,绑定邀请关系”揭示了这个项目是一个专门为手机应用程序设计的响应式下载页面。它采用了一个设计模板,名为“模板2”,旨在适应不同设备的屏幕尺寸,提供一致的用户体验。此页面的关键特性是它支持用户在无需手动输入邀请码的情况下进行下载,同时能够自动绑定用户的邀请关系。这样的功能对于推广和跟踪用户活动,尤其是在多级营销或推荐系统中非常重要。 描述中的“纯html,已经接入蛋壳追踪sdk支持免填邀请码,绑定邀请关系,jquery html版本”进一步详细说明了页面的实现技术。纯HTML意味着这个页面主要由HTML代码构建,提供了基础的结构和内容。jQuery是一个流行的JavaScript库,用于简化DOM操作、事件处理和动画效果,这里用于增强页面交互性。蛋壳追踪SDK(Software Development Kit)是一个第三方服务,已集成到这个页面中,其作用是收集和分析用户行为数据,尤其是与邀请码相关的部分。通过SDK,开发者可以追踪用户是否使用了邀请码,以及邀请关系是如何建立的,这对于评估营销策略的效果和优化用户体验非常有帮助。 标签“html”、“jquery”和“蛋壳追踪”分别对应了项目中使用的主要技术。HTML是网页的基本语言,用于创建和组织页面内容。jQuery是增强HTML页面动态性的工具,而“蛋壳追踪”则强调了数据分析和用户行为监控的功能。 在压缩包的文件列表中,我们看到有以下文件: 1. `index.html` - 这是网页的主入口文件,包含HTML标记和可能内嵌的JavaScript及CSS代码。 2. `a2.png` 和 `a1.png` - 这些是图像资源,可能用作页面的图形元素,如按钮、图标或者背景。 3. `style.css` - 这个文件包含CSS样式规则,用于定义页面的视觉呈现,包括颜色、布局和字体等。 这个项目是一个基于HTML和jQuery的响应式APP下载页面,集成蛋壳追踪SDK以实现用户邀请码管理和行为追踪。开发者通过这个页面可以轻松地监控用户下载行为,分析邀请码的使用情况,并根据收集的数据优化推广策略。页面的设计和功能体现了现代Web开发中的交互性、适应性和数据分析的重要性。
2025-04-09 08:29:26 1.91MB html jquery
1
【项目资源】:包含前端、后端、移动开发、操作系统、人工智能、物联网、信息化管理、数据库、硬件开发、大数据、课程资源、音视频、网站开发等各种技术项目的源码。包括STM32、ESP8266、PHP、QT、Linux、iOS、C++、Java、python、web、C#、EDA、proteus、RTOS等项目的源码。【项目质量】:所有源码都经过严格测试,可以直接运行。功能在确认正常工作后才上传。【适用人群】:适用于希望学习不同技术领域的小白或进阶学习者。可作为毕设项目、课程设计、大作业、工程实训或初期项目立项。【附加价值】:项目具有较高的学习借鉴价值,也可直接拿来修改复刻。对于有一定基础或热衷于研究的人来说,可以在这些基础代码上进行修改和扩展,实现其他功能。【沟通交流】:有任何使用上的问题,欢迎随时与博主沟通,博主会及时解答。鼓励下载和使用,并欢迎大家互相学习,共同进步。
2025-04-08 09:49:55 3.5MB
1
YOLOv8是一种先进的实时对象检测系统,它是YOLO系列模型的最新版本,具有速度和准确性的均衡。将YOLOv8部署到Web上,可以让用户通过浏览器实时进行图像识别,这在很多应用场景中非常有用,比如在智能安防、智能物流和自动驾驶等领域。 要实现YOLOv8的Web部署,我们通常会选择一个后端框架来处理服务器端的逻辑,这里使用的是Django。Django是一个功能强大的Python Web框架,它鼓励快速开发和干净、实用的设计。它的一个重要特点是自带ORM(Object-Relational Mapping)系统,允许开发者使用Python语言编写数据库查询,而无需编写SQL代码。 在本项目中,Django将作为后端服务器,处理来自前端的请求,执行YOLOv8模型的对象检测,并返回结果。此外,前端使用HTML构建,这是构建Web页面的标准标记语言,通过HTML可以设计用户界面并展示YOLOv8检测后的图像结果。 在实际部署过程中,首先需要在Django项目中集成YOLOv8模型。这通常涉及到以下几个步骤: 1. 安装必要的Python库,包括Django和其他相关的图像处理库。 2. 在Django项目中创建一个应用,用于处理YOLOv8相关的逻辑。 3. 在该应用中创建一个模型,用于存储待检测的图片信息和检测结果。 4. 编写视图函数或类来处理HTTP请求,这些视图将调用YOLOv8模型进行图像检测。 5. 通过Django的ORM系统,将图片数据保存到数据库中,并将处理后的结果存储起来。 6. 创建HTML模板文件,用于展示上传图片和显示检测结果的界面。 7. 配置路由,确保用户可以通过访问特定的URL来触发图片上传和检测的过程。 在前端展示方面,利用HTML可以设计一个简洁直观的用户界面。用户可以通过这个界面上传图片,然后通过JavaScript与Django后端交互,将图片数据发送到服务器。服务器处理完数据后,前端页面可以接收处理结果,并在适当的位置展示出来。 对于YOLOv8模型,它是在Docker容器中运行还是直接在服务器上部署,这取决于实际的应用需求和环境配置。但无论哪种部署方式,都需要确保模型能够稳定运行,并与Django后端无缝对接。 在安全性和性能方面,部署Web应用时还需要考虑数据的安全性,如使用HTTPS协议加密数据传输,以及采取适当措施防止常见的网络攻击。此外,性能优化也是部署过程中不可忽视的一个环节,比如合理配置服务器资源,优化代码以减少不必要的计算和数据传输,使用缓存策略等。 YOLOv8在Web上的部署涉及到的技术和步骤较为复杂,需要前后端开发者紧密合作,共同实现一个高效、稳定且用户友好的实时图像识别Web应用。
2025-04-06 22:25:49 111.35MB Django HTML
1
本文参考链接详细介绍如何使用Jsoup包抓取HTML数据,是一个纯java工程,并将其打包成jar包。希望了解如何用java语言爬虫网页的可以看下。详见博文: http://blog.csdn.net/yanzi1225627/article/details/38308963
2025-04-06 19:16:02 385KB jsoup
1